Open Source Headless eCommerce Platform
Open Source Headless eCommerce Platform
Connect any frontend to a complete REST API. Build storefronts, B2B portals, marketplaces, and mobile apps on one commerce backend. No GraphQL lock-in. No platform fees.
Spree has been built API-first and comes with full service support
Open Source eCommerce API
Two production-grade REST APIs: Store API for storefronts and mobile apps, Admin API for back-office integrations and ERP connections. Full OpenAPI 3.0 specs you can import into Postman in seconds. Flat JSON responses, no GraphQL required. Unified Payment Sessions API for Stripe, Adyen, and any PSP.
eCommerce SDK and Developer Tooling
Official TypeScript SDK and CLI to scaffold new projects in one command. Production-grade Next.js starter with React 19 and Tailwind CSS 4. Spree ships AGENTS.md and a dedicated MCP server for documentation, so AI coding assistants like Claude and Cursor build on actual architecture, not hallucinated endpoints.
Agentic Commerce Ready
Spree’s REST APIs are natively compatible with emerging agentic commerce protocols: OpenAI ACP, Google UCP, Anthropic MCP, and Visa TAP. All operate over HTTP/REST, so AI purchasing agents can discover products, manage carts, and complete checkout programmatically. Build AI-powered storefronts or automated procurement on one open-source headless ecommerce platform.